Summary
Custom acetabular components offer a solution for severe bone loss in revision total hip arthroplasty (THA). CT-based planning and custom implants provide stable fixation and improved hip biomechanics in complex cases.

Background:
- Severe acetabular bone loss, especially Paprosky type IIIA defects, presents a significant challenge in revision total hip arthroplasty (THA).
- Standard implants often lack the necessary stability and fixation for these complex cases.
- Custom-made acetabular components, utilizing computed tomography (CT)-based three-dimensional (3D) planning, offer a tailored solution.
